Materials science is a multi-disciplinary field that focuses on designing and discovering new materials. It uses concepts from physics, chemistry and engineering. Materials science is an interdisciplinary field which combines areas such as metallurgy, solid-state physics, ceramics and chemistry. It is concerned with the processing of any material and how it influences the structure, properties and performance of the material. This understanding of processing, structure and properties of the material is known as materials paradigm. This paradigm is helpful in getting a better understanding of various research areas such as metallurgy, nanotechnology and biomaterials. Materials science is an important part of forensic engineering and failure analysis which includes investing products, materials, components or structures that do not function as expected.
